Home Tags Brian Flores lawsuit

Tag: Brian Flores lawsuit

The NFL Is Festering With Problems

0
This is not how the NFL wanted to promote the Super Bowl. https://www.youtube.com/watch?v=sD8i71J6aUA For those looking for NBC to explain the Brian Flores lawsuit, the Hue...